Problems solved by technology

[0003] The winding machine in the prior art has only one reciprocating wire guide device, and no matter what changes it makes for different fibers (tows), it is impossible to change the angle α at which the reciprocating wire guide device drives the fiber to swing back and forth is too large, because Restricted by various aspects and the height of its own design, it is impossible to reduce α, which makes the horizontal friction of the fiber on the yarn feeding wheel and the yarn guide of the reciprocating yarn guide device large, and the tension change also increases accordingly, which is prone to rubbing and yarn wide variation, such as Figure 5 shown
In addition, when the fiber is reciprocating, it swings back and forth at the wire feeding wheel, which makes the fiber prone to "scratch" at the wire feeding wheel, which affects the quality of the fiber

Abstract

The invention particularly relates to a double-yarn guide device of a winding machine. The double-yarn guide device comprises a first reciprocating yarn guide device and a second reciprocating yarn guide device, the first reciprocating yarn guide device comprises a first reciprocating mechanism and a first yarn guide mechanism, and the first yarn guide mechanism is fixedly connected to the first reciprocating mechanism through a first sliding block connecting piece; the second reciprocating yarn guide device comprises a second reciprocating mechanism and a second yarn guide mechanism, and the second yarn guide mechanism is fixedly connected to the second reciprocating mechanism through a second sliding block connecting piece; and fibers are led in through a yarn guide wheel, sequentially pass through the first yarn guide mechanism and the second yarn guide mechanism and are wound on a spindle of the winding machine, and the first reciprocating yarn guide device and the second reciprocating yarn guide device are controlled through a controller and achieve synchronous reciprocating motion. The first reciprocating yarn guide device and the second reciprocating yarn guide device are controlled through the controller and achieve synchronous reciprocating motion, the angle of reciprocating swinging of the fibers driven by the reciprocating yarn guide devices is reduced, and yarn rubbing and yarn damage are avoided.
